Read news articleUno, a three-year-old beagle made history yesterday, after winning "Best in Show" at the Westminster Kennel Club dog show held in Madison Square Garden, New York. This is the first time in the 132-year history of the competition that a beagle has won the title and the crowd cheered, giving Uno a standing ovation....
